Description : Position Purpose
Position Purpose
- The Systems Administrator maintains and supports the company’s IT systems, infrastructure, employees, and associates. Individual will configure, maintain and support systems that will further the goals of the cooperative;
- maintain the security and redundancy of all MBG information systems; review, upgrade and support MBG’s on-premise hardware and cloud infrastructure;
perform all network, security and database administration functions.

Primary Accountabilities and Responsibilities
- Provide first call resolution whenever possible
- Diagnosing and resolving hardware, software, networking, communication, and system issues when they arise
- Configure and maintain internal infrastructure including, laptop and desktop computers, servers, routers, switches, wireless access points, firewalls, printers, VOIP, desk / mobile phones, internet, intranet, LANs, & WANs
- Primary responsibility for administration of Microsoft O365 and email environment
- Day-to-day administration, backup, and maintenance of SQL database systems
- Ensure security of the organization's systems and information assets for both on-premises and cloud environments
- Configure, maintain, and monitor backup operations and disaster recovery systems
- Maintain and support audio-visual equipment and conferencing tools
- Designs and implements infrastructure solutions to meet business and technical objectives
- Work to gather technology requirements, implement policies, standards, security, and establish best practices
- Determining root causes of system, network, and hardware issues. Provide answers, investigate problems, document solutions, and provide training to system users as required
- Part of the core team to lead the development and implementation of value-added efficiencies through system integration and automation
- Provide management with Service Desk reporting and advise on ways to improve stability and downtime cost reduction on the desktops and network
- Responsible for prioritizing service desk calls according to business impact

Quantitative Data / Job Dimensions
- Maintain IT systems at multiple offices and operational facilities : desktops, laptops, servers, tablets, cellphones, switches, wireless networks, firewalls and printers
- Configure, deploy, maintain and improve the Windows server environment on-premises and in cloud
- Maintain Active Directory users, groups, sites and GPO
- Maintain multiple security systems across all domains, including application and database security, network security, access controls, firewalls, encryption, and intrusion detection
- Responsible for assisting other IT personnel in the support of users at additional locations in North America
- Shared responsibility with Systems Analyst peers for tier 1 support of hardware and software resolution for approximately 100 company users
- Travel to train and support users. Travel is up to 10% during the harvest season (both in and out of state) and 5% during the non-harvest period
- Must be available for 24x7 support (rotation schedule)
